Devonte Williams (born February 5, 1997) is an American professional football running back for the Ottawa Redblacks of the Canadian Football League (CFL).
College career
Williams first played college football for the Indiana Hoosiers in 2015 as a cornerback, where he played and started in three games before suffering a season-ending injury.{{Cite web |title=Devonte Williams |url=https://iuhoosiers.com/sports/football/roster/devonte-williams/9743 |access-date=October 16, 2023 |publisher=Indiana Hoosiers}} He used a medical redshirt year in 2015 and returned to his position of running back in 2016 and 2017.
He then transferred to Southeastern Louisiana University to play for the Lions in 2018 and 2019, where he played in 23 games and had 222 carries for 892 yards and 12 touchdowns.{{Cite web |title=Devonte Williams |url=https://jmusports.com/sports/football/roster/bryce-carter/17275 |access-date=October 16, 2023 |publisher=Southeastern Louisiana Lions}}
Professional career
=Winnipeg Blue Bombers=
After not playing in 2020 due to the COVID-19 pandemic, Williams signed with the Winnipeg Blue Bombers on July 13, 2021.{{Cite web |date=July 13, 2021 |title=Bombers bring in RB Devonte Williams |url=https://www.cfl.ca/2021/07/13/bombers-bring-rb-devonte-williams/ |publisher=Canadian Football League}} Following training camp, he began the season on the practice roster and was eventually released on September 30, 2021.{{Cite web |title=Transactions – Football player trades and signings |url=https://www.cfl.ca/transactions/2021/ |access-date=October 16, 2023 |publisher=Canadian Football League}}
=Ottawa Redblacks=
On April 20, 2022, it was announced that Williams had signed with the Ottawa Redblacks.{{Cite web |date=April 20, 2022 |title=Redblacks sign OL Jeremy Hickey and RB Devonte Williams |url=https://www.ottawaredblacks.com/2022/04/20/redblacks-sign-ol-jeremy-hickey-and-rb-devonte-williams/ |publisher=Ottawa Redblacks}} After the team's incumbent starting running back, William Powell, suffered an injury in training camp, Williams was named the opening day starter. He made his professional debut on June 10, 2022, against the Winnipeg Blue Bombers, where he had nine carries for 33 yards.{{Cite web |title=Devonte Williams |url=https://www.ottawaredblacks.com/players/devonte-williams-2/165992/ |access-date=October 14, 2023 |publisher=Ottawa Redblacks}} He started in the first two games of the regular season before relinquishing his position to Powell and Williams was assigned to the practice roster.{{Cite web |title=Transactions – Football player trades and signings |url=https://www.cfl.ca/transactions/2022/ |access-date=October 16, 2023 |publisher=Canadian Football League}} Following another injury to Powell, Williams returned and played in six more regular season games and totalled 90 carries for 454 yards and 27 receptions for 159 yards for the year. At the end of the year, he was named the Redblacks' nominee for the CFL's Most Outstanding Rookie Award.{{Cite web |last=Jhalli |first=Anil |date=October 26, 2022 |title=Redblacks reveal team award winners |url=https://ottawa.citynews.ca/2022/10/26/redblacks-reveal-team-award-winners-6010288/ |access-date=February 19, 2024 |website=CityNews}}
After the Redblacks decided not to re-sign Powell, Williams became the starting running back for the 2023 season. He scored his first career touchdown on a 23-yard run in a game against the Edmonton Elks on August 27, 2023.
Personal life
Williams' was born to parents Harmony and Isaac Williams. Williams' uncles, Shawn Springs and Omar Evans, also played professional football in the National Football League and Canadian Football League, respectively.{{Cite web |date=July 12, 2022 |title=“Its been a complete blessing” Ottawa Redblacks running back Devonte Williams looks back on his story |url=https://jzmedia.ca/2022/07/12/devontewilliamsthematrix/ |publisher=JZ Media}} Williams' grandfather, Ron Springs, played at running back for the Dallas Cowboys and Tampa Bay Buccaneers.
